P4202AA Equivalent & Substitute Parts
Part Overview
The P4202AA is a Transient Voltage Suppressor (TVS) thyristor manufactured by Littelfuse Inc. as part of the SIDACtor® series. This component is designed for overvoltage protection applications, featuring a 190V/380V off-state voltage rating with 150A peak pulse current capability in a 3-SIP through-hole package. The P4202AA is currently classified as obsolete, making identification of functionally equivalent alternatives essential for ongoing system support and new design implementations.

Key Parameters
| Parameter | Value |
|---|---|
| Voltage - Breakover | 250V, 500V |
| Voltage - Off State | 190V, 380V |
| Voltage - On State | 4 V |
| Current - Peak Pulse (8/20µs) | 150 A |
| Current - Peak Pulse (10/1000µs) | 45 A |
| Current - Hold (Ih) | 150 mA |
| Number of Elements | 2 |
| Capacitance | 20pF, 35pF |
| Mounting Type | Through Hole |
| Package / Case | 3-SIP |
| Supplier Device Package | TO-220 Modified |
Substitute Part Grouping Explanation
Substitution of the P4202AA is determined by strict equivalence across electrical and mechanical parameters. The primary substitute, P4202AALRP, maintains identical electrical specifications including breakover voltage (250V, 500V), off-state voltage (190V, 380V), on-state voltage (4V), peak pulse current ratings (150A at 8/20µs and 45A at 10/1000µs), hold current (150 mA), element count (2), and capacitance values (20pF, 35pF). Both components utilize the same 3-SIP package configuration with TO-220 Modified supplier device packaging and through-hole mounting technology.
The key differentiator between these parts is packaging format and product status. The P4202AALRP is supplied in Tape & Reel (TR) format and maintains Active product status, whereas the P4202AA is obsolete. Both components are classified under ECCN EAR99 and share identical HTSUS coding (8541.30.0080).

Engineering Selection Recommendations
The P4202AALRP is the direct functional equivalent for the obsolete P4202AA. Selection of P4202AALRP is appropriate for applications requiring continued supply of this TVS thyristor topology. The substitute part maintains complete electrical and mechanical compatibility while offering the advantage of Active product status, ensuring long-term availability and supply chain continuity.
The P4202AALRP provides improved regulatory compliance through ROHS3 certification, whereas the P4202AA is RoHS non-compliant. For new designs or systems requiring regulatory compliance documentation, P4202AALRP is the appropriate selection. Both components share identical electrical performance characteristics and package geometry, supporting direct substitution in existing through-hole PCB layouts.
